Historical Context: From Mechanical Reels to Digital Realms
The origins of slot machines trace back to the late 19th century, with mechanical devices offering straightforward gameplay and limited themes. The advent of digital technology revolutionized this domain, transforming these mechanical constructs into vibrant, computer-generated visuals. By the early 2000s, online casinos proliferated, offering virtual slots that maintained core features but expanded significantly in complexity and variety.
| Year | Innovation | Impact |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| Introduction of Random Number Generators (RNGs) | Ensured fairness, increased player trust |
| 2010 | 3D graphics and immersive themes | Enhanced visual appeal and engagement |
| 2020 | Integration of AR and VR technologies | Revolutionized user experience, creating virtual casinos |
Industry Insights: The Strategic Role of Quality and Fairness
As digital slot markets grow saturated, suppliers and operators must lean into quality assurance and transparency to maintain credibility. Industry standards dictate rigorous testing protocols, including certified RNGs, to prevent tampering and ensure randomness. The advent of certifications such as eCOGRA and GLI testing exemplifies this commitment, fostering trust among an increasingly discerning audience.

Technological Confluence: Merging Fantasy with Data-Driven Design
Modern slot games leverage complex algorithms and data analytics to optimise payout structures and game difficulty, balancing entertainment with profitability. For example, the use of Return to Player (RTP) percentages guides developers in designing the game’s payout ratio, often targeted around 96-98%, aligning with industry averages.
Interactive features such as bonus rounds, cascading symbols, and progressive jackpots identify trends aimed at boosting user engagement and retention. These innovations, combined with high-definition graphics and theme-rich narratives, exemplify a parallel with traditional storytelling, but calibrated for digital consumption.
Why Authenticity and Responsible Gaming Matter
As players engage with increasingly complex and rewarding virtual environments, industry stakeholders bear the responsibility to promote integrity and safety. Responsible gaming practices, including self-exclusion tools and spending limits, are now integrated within many platforms. Additionally, credible benchmarks ensure that game design considers promoting fair play and protecting vulnerable users.
The Future Trajectory: Leveraging AI and Blockchain
The path forward for digital slot innovation includes the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) to personalise gaming experiences and the adoption of blockchain technology for enhanced transparency and security. Blockchain, in particular, offers transparent audit trails, enabling players to verify payout fairness independently—a step further in establishing industry-wide trustworthiness.
